Peshawar vs Vicosa Climate & Distance Between

Brazil flag
  • The distance between Peshawar, Pakistan and Vicosa, Brazil is approximately 13,484 km or 8,379 mi.
  • To reach Peshawar in this distance one would set out from Vicosa bearing 62°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Peshawar bearing 84.8° or E .
  • Peshawar has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as Vicosa has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
  • Peshawar is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ome whereas Vicosa is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
  • The annual average temperature is 3.3 °C (5.9°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 15 °C (27°F) more in Peshawar.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 817.5 mm (32.2 in) less which is equivalent to 817.5 l/m² (20.06 US gal/ft²) or 8,175,000 l/ha (873,962 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.7° lower in Peshawar than in Vicosa.
